Course Content

• Introduction to Forest Stewardship Council (FSC) & Programme for the Endorsement of Forest Certification (PEFC) Standards
• Chain of Custody Certification: Principles and Implementation for Timber
• Legal Compliance and Due Diligence in Timber Procurement
• Sustainable Forest Management Practices and Timber Certification
• Traceability Systems and Documentation in Timber Supply Chains
• Auditing and Monitoring for Timber Certification Compliance
• Risk Assessment and Mitigation in Timber Certification
• Conflict Minerals and Illegal Logging in Timber Supply Chains
• Timber Certification Schemes Comparison: FSC vs PEFC
• Stakeholder Engagement and Communication in Timber Certification
